Каталог: Учебник по DELPHI 5 -- bl_pg.exe 4/11/2000 Документ: READ ME -- read_me_bl.txt -- Origenal HomeSite "KUDRUAVTSEV.NAROD.RU" PAYBACK co. =-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-= Спасибо что зашли на мой сайт и за то время которое вы потратили на погрузку данного каталога --------------------------------------------------------------------- Здесь вы найдёте: * ---> --Создание COM-объектов средствами Delphi --Пространство имён оболочки Windows --Графика *Работа с палитрой *Заполнить Canvas рисунком с рабочего стола *Список графических файлов с их изображениями *Как из Delphi рисовать в любой части экрана или в чужом окне *Написание текста под углом *Преобразование цвета RGB у HLS (яркость,насыщенность,оттенок) *Число цветов у данного компьютера *Копирование экрана *Нарисовать "неактивный"(disable) текст *Как менять разрешение экрана по ходу выполнения программы *Как поместить картинку из базы данных, например MsSQL, в компонент TIMAGE ? --Система (Советы для написания программ-инсталляторов, Мини-Вирусов и Внешних модулей DLL) *Регистрация программ в меню "Пуск" Windows 95 *Как программно создать ярлык? *Затенить кнопку закрыть в заголовке формы *Копирование файлов *Как скопировать все файлы вместе с подкаталогами *Удаление каталога со всем содержимым *Определение системной информации *Как проинсталлировать свои шрифты? *Вставить какую-нибудь программу внутрь EXE файла *Хочется создать ну очень маленький инсталлятор *Рисую две иконки 32х32 и 16х16, но под NT 32х32 не показывается! *Работа с принтером *Хранитель экрана Включение/выключение клавиатуры, мыши и монитора! *Переключение языка из программы на Delphi *Как отловить нажатия клавиш для всех процессов в системе? *Информация о состоянии клавиатуры *Управление питанием ЭВМ из Delphi *Пример получения списка запущенных приложений. *Как отключить показ кнопки программы в TaskBar и по Alt-Tab и в Ctrl-Alt-Del *Добавление программы в автозапуск *Удалить файл в корзину? Запросто! *Добавить ссылку на мой файл в меню Пуск|Документы *Устанавливаем свой WallPaper для Windows *Как запретить кнопку Close [x] в заголовке окна. *Каким образом можно изменить системное меню формы? *Запуск внешней программы и ожидание ее завершения *Как узнать местоположение специальных папок у Windows? *Как воспроизвести wav-файл из ресурса (в EXE) ? *Как скрыть таскбар? *События нажатия на системные кнопки формы (минимизация, закрытие...) *Сети. Как подключить и отключить сетевой дисковод из своей программы? *Надо подключить DLL и использовать некоторые ее функции. *Как передать при создании нити (Tthread) ей некоторое значение? *CGI-програма должна выдавать в браузер Gif изображение. --Звук *Звук через BEEPER *Изменение громкости звуков в Windows --Реестр *Использование некоторых ключей реестра *Добавление элементов в контекстное меню "Создать" *Путь к файлу который открывает не зарегистрированные файлы *В проводнике контекстное меню "Открыть в новом окне" *Использование средней кнопки мыши Logitech в качестве двойного щелчка *Новые звуковые события *Путь в реестре для деинсталяции программ *Работа с реестром в Delphi 1 *Объект INIFILES - работа INI файлами --Прочее *Как получить горизонтальную прокрутку (scrollbar) в ListBox? *Поиск строки в ListBox *Как вставить несколько строк в середину StringGrid или после определенной строки? *Пример получения позиции курсора из компоненты TMemo. *Функция Undo в TMemo *Как прокрутить текст в Tmemo или в TRichEdit *Как определить работает ли уже данное приложение или это первая его копия? *Пример вывода сообщения одной командой и ввода строки тоже одной командой. *Перетаскивание формы за ее поле. *Обработка событий от клавиатуры (перехват клавиатуры от других программ !) *Как сделать так, что при нажатии на Enter происходил переход к следующему элементу формы *Вставка и удаление компонент в форму в design-time *Перетаскивание файла drag-drop *Привлечение внимания к окну *Заставка для программы (splash form) *Прозрачная форма ! *Как получить короткий путь файла если имеется длинный ("c:\Program Files" ==> "c:\progra~1") *Как создать свою кнопку в заголовке формы (на Caption Bar) *Преобразование текста OEM у Ansi *Состояние кнопки insert (Insert/Overwrite) *Сводка функций модуля Math *Внутри конструктора Create компонента создаю другой компонент, но Delphi помещает запись о втором компоненте в dfm-файл! *Как вставить иконку (или bitmap) в TRichEdit, причем так, чтобы пользователь мог ее удалить нажатием клавиши Del (как это сделано в Microsoft Word)? *TImage *QReport --FAQ по DELPHI Как правильно создавать компоненты в run-time? Как в TTreeView построить дерево открытых окон? Как заставить клавишу "Enter" вести себя как "Tab" в DBGrid? Как узнать, какая ячейка при просмотре TDBGrid текущая? Как использовать Clipboard для переноса данных в собственном формате? Как перевести визуальный компонент, такой, как TPanel, в состояние перемещения (взять и перенести)? Как изменить внешний вид хинтов (всплывающих подсказок)? Как изменить цвет фона и шрифта в TDBGrid в зависимости от содержимого? Как добавить горизонтальную полосу прокрутки в TListBox? Как создать окна непрямоугольной формы и работать с ними? Как обратится из одной модальной формы к другой - не активной? Как добавить свой пункт в системное меню формы? Как с помощью TDBGrid.RowSelected получить доступ к записям TTable, соответствующим строкам, помеченным в TDBGrid? Можно ли задать формат/маску вывода числа в столбце DBGrid? Использование обработчика OnHint при наличии нескольких форм. Переход на другую страницу TabSet по имени. Как выполнить UnDo в Memo. Как можно определить, на какой строке в TMemo находится курсор? Обработка исключительных ситуаций (exceptions) EDBEngineError. Как открыть ComboBox программно. Как программно спрятать/показать заголовок окна (caption)? Как убрать заголовок(caption) из MDI child? Мне нужно сделать приложение модальным, для того чтобы обезопасить систему и в то же время позволить работать с программой. Прокрутка Memo (постранично), фокус находится на Edit1. Как сделать окно, которое перетаскивается не за заголовок (caption), а за все поле. Как поместить BitMap в меню? -=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=- Автор: Кудрявцев Юра (последнее обновление: 4/11/2000) Internet: http://kudruavtsev.narod.ru http://www.kudruavtsev.narod.ru mailto: backpayback_yura@mail.ru Орг. PAYBACK со. #2000г. ---------------------------------------------------------------------